Man faces child neglect charge after leading police on chase in Portage

(Photo supplied)

An Illinois man is accused of neglect and more after leading police on a chase with a baby in the car.

Christopher Gibson was arrested after a Portage police officer saw Gibson pull out of a Days Inn and drive over a raised median.

When the officer tried to pull Gibson over he drove away.

When the car stopped, Gibson got out and looked like he was surrendering before he backed away and began to run.

Police used a stun gun to stop him.

Police found a baby in the backseat, the boy’s mother came and got him, said the Times of Northwest Indiana.
